Discrepancy in Concrete Mixture – Francisco Cuevas Lopez

I think in this case the architect should withhold the final payment for the contractor since the contractor did not follow the contract document. Revise the contract documents and try to find legal advise, since any inconvenience due to the negligence of the contractor and the owner could bring legal problems to the architect.

The architect can request a written variance from the building department for the code violention, and request the owner to give him a written document that the architect has no further responsibility for the material being used. And then terminate the architect’s contract with the owner.
